Canadian seafood producers will have a much easier time exporting product to South Korea and vice versa after the two countries agreed to a free trade deal Tuesday.

Although all the details have yet to be released, companies such as Ocean Choice International are already applauding the deal after nearly a decade of negotiations.

Martin Sullivan, president and CEO of Ocean Choice, told IntraFish the trade agreement will have “a very positive impact on seafood industry.”

“Asia is the world’s fastest growing economic region and seafood imports into this market will provide us with the opportunity to enhance our market presence throughout Korea and all of Asia,” Sullivan said.
